WebOct 27, 2024 · 80,000 / (500 * 20) = 8 GPM So, this means that my total system needs to move 8 gallons per minute in order to meet demand. In my scenario, I actually have two zone pumps (one does a bonus room, which needs about 2-3 GPM, and the other does the main house, which needs about 5 GPM).
